Human hair wigs, celebrated for their natural appearance and styling versatility, require careful maintenance to preserve their quality and extend their lifespan. Unlike synthetic wigs, human hair wigs can last for years with proper care, closely mimicking the texture and movement of natural hair. Therefore, the maintenance methods for human hair wigs differ from those for synthetic wigs. Understanding Human Hair Wigs
Human hair wigs are crafted from real human hair, collected and processed to create a variety of styles and textures. Due to their natural origin, these wigs require similar maintenance routines as natural hair, including regular washing, conditioning, and styling. However, without the scalp’s natural oils, extra care is needed to prevent dryness and damage.
Washing and Conditioning
1. Frequency
Human hair wigs do not need to be washed as often as your natural hair. Depending on usage, washing every 2 to 4 weeks is sufficient. Over-washing can lead to dryness and shorten the wig’s lifespan.
2. Shampoo and Conditioner
Use s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ners designed for treated or colored hair. These products are gentler and help retain the wig’s moisture balance. Apply conditioner from the mid-lengths to the ends, avoiding the base to prevent loosening the knots.
3. Drying
After washing, gently blot excess water with a towel and let the wig air dry on a wig stand. Avoid wringing or rubbing the wig. For those who prefer using a blow dryer, use the lowest heat setting to prevent damage.
Styling and Heat Protection
Human hair wigs can be styled much like your own hair. However, frequent use of heat styling tools can cause damage over time. Always apply a heat protectant spray before using straighteners, curling irons, or blow dryers. Opt for ceramic or tourmaline tools that distribute heat more evenly, and avoid setting the temperature too high.
Nightly Care
To prevent tangling and breakage, remove your wig at night and place it on a wig stand. If you must wear your wig to bed, consider braiding it loosely or wrapping it in a silk scarf to minimize friction.
Storage
When not in use, store your wig on a wig stand or mannequin head to maintain its shape. Keep it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ight, which can fade the color and degrade the hair quality.
Regular Maintenance
1. Deep Conditioning
Treat your wig to a deep conditioning treatment every few months to restore moisture and elasticity. This is especially important for longer wigs, which are more prone to dryness at the ends.
2. Professional Services
Consider taking your wig to a professional stylist for regular maintenance, including trimming split ends and refreshing the style. Professionals can also address any issues with the wig cap or adjust the fit as needed.
Avoiding Damage
- Chemical Treatments: Be cautious with dyeing, perming, or chemically straightening your wig. These processes can be harsh and reduce the wig’s lifespan. Consult with a professional stylist specialized in wigs to minimize risks.
- Swimming and Exposure to Sun: Wear a swim cap to protect your wig from chlorine or saltwater. Limit exposure to the sun to prevent color fading and hair damage.
